Recently elected President of Poland officially calls final reports on the 2010 Smolensk presidential plane crash "unfounded theories?.

In an official letter to participants of the fourth "Smolensk conference", organised by the proponents of conspiracy theories on the April 10th 2010 aviation accident that killed President Lech Kaczynski and 95 other people, President of Poland Andrzej Duda praised the members of the "independent investigation effort" and called Russian and Polish final reports "hypotheses, which can not withstand confrontation with the scientific analysis of available photographic and video documentation". He concluded that causes and circumstances of the Smolensk crash haven't been established yet.

Members of Law and Justice, former opposition and now the ruling party in Poland, dismiss the results of the official investigation published in 2011 and announce reopening the inquiry with re-staffed State Commission of Aircraft Accident Investigation.

Conspiracy theories will most likely become officially supported "truth". Ideological cleansing may jeopardise SCAAI's ability to perform its duties. In March 2015 the Polish "Parliamentary Committee for Investigation of the Tu-154M Crash" (a single-party body chaired by Law and Justice vice-president Antoni Macierewicz) presented a paper on the causes of the 2010 crash of the Polish presidential aircraft in Smolensk, which very well defines the nature of possible "investigation" - see my comment and commented original .
